The Transparency Gap in Modern Fashion
1. Data Silos Across Tier‑One and Tier‑Two Suppliers
Most apparel manufacturers rely on a patchwork of Excel files, email threads, and legacy ERP systems. Information about raw material origin, chemical usage, or labor standards often lives in separate databases that never talk to each other. This fragmentation makes it impossible to generate a unified sustainability report without weeks of manual aggregation.
2. Inconsistent Standards and Certifications
Different regions recognise different certifications (e.g., GOTS, OEKO‑Tex, Fair Trade). Suppliers may claim compliance without providing the necessary audit documentation, leading to false‑positive claims that erode consumer trust.
3. Real‑Time Decision‑Making Is Rare
When a batch of cotton shows excessive pesticide residues, the reaction is typically delayed until after the product ships, resulting in costly recalls. Real‑time alerts could prevent such fallout, but existing tools lack the speed and granularity required.
4. Regulatory Pressure
EU’s ESG Disclosure Regulation and the U.S. Supply Chain Act demand detailed, verifiable data about environmental impact and labor practices. Non‑compliance can lead to fines, legal exposure, and reputational damage.
How AI Form Builder Bridges the Gap
Formize.ai’s AI Form Builder is a web‑based, cross‑platform solution that leverages natural‑language processing (NLP) and machine‑learning to streamline data capture across the entire fashion supply chain.
Key Features Aligned with Sustainable Fashion
| Feature | Sustainable‑Fashion Impact |
|---|---|
| AI‑Assisted Form Creation | Templates for fiber sourcing, dye‑chemistry logs, and worker‑hour reporting are auto‑generated from a single prompt, cutting setup time by up to 70 %. |
| Auto‑Fill and Validation | The AI reads supplier invoices, shipping manifests, and lab certificates to auto‑populate fields, flagging inconsistencies instantly. |
| Real‑Time Aggregation | As soon as a supplier submits a form, the data streams into a centralized dashboard, updating carbon‑footprint calculations in seconds. |
| Compliance Q&A Bot | An embedded chatbot guides suppliers through certification requirements, ensuring that each required document is attached. |
| Export to ESG Reporting Formats | One‑click conversion to GRI, SASB, or custom CSV formats eliminates manual re‑formatting. |
Because the platform runs entirely in the browser, field workers, auditors, and brand managers can access the same forms from laptops, tablets, or smartphones, even in remote textile hubs with limited connectivity.
Real‑Time Data Capture Workflow
Below is a simplified end‑to‑end workflow that illustrates how an apparel brand can move from raw material request to a live sustainability dashboard. The diagram is rendered using Mermaid.
flowchart TD
A["Brand initiates Material Request"] --> B["AI Form Builder generates Supplier Form"]
B --> C["Supplier uploads raw material certificates"]
C --> D["AI auto‑fills material origin, water usage, carbon factor"]
D --> E["Validation Engine flags missing GOTS proof"]
E --> F["Supplier receives bot‑guided remediation suggestions"]
F --> G["Corrected data submitted"]
G --> H["Real‑time aggregation updates Dashboard"]
H --> I["Carbon footprint & compliance score displayed"]
I --> J["Brand makes procurement decision"]
Explanation of the nodes
- Brand initiates Material Request – The design team creates a new collection specification inside the brand’s PLM system.
- AI Form Builder generates Supplier Form – A one‑click action produces a custom form that captures fiber type, country of origin, dye chemicals, and labor certifications.
- Supplier uploads raw material certificates – PDFs, images, or JSON files are attached directly to the form.
- AI auto‑fills material origin, water usage, carbon factor – Using OCR and pretrained sustainability models, the system extracts numeric values and populates hidden fields.
- Validation Engine flags missing GOTS proof – Business rules check for mandatory certifications and raise a warning if absent.
- Supplier receives bot‑guided remediation suggestions – An interactive chat window explains what documents are needed and where to obtain them.
- Corrected data submitted – The supplier re‑uploads the missing certificate.
- Real‑time aggregation updates Dashboard – The central analytics engine recalculates the collection’s total carbon footprint.
- Carbon footprint & compliance score displayed – Stakeholders see a live metric that can be used for decision‑making.
- Brand makes procurement decision – Based on the real‑time score, the brand can approve, renegotiate, or reject the material batch.

Implementation Blueprint for Fashion Brands
- Stakeholder Alignment – Assemble a cross‑functional team (design, sourcing, sustainability, IT) to define data objectives and compliance requirements.
- Template Creation – Use the AI Form Builder’s natural‑language prompt: “Create a form to capture GOTS‑certified organic cotton details, water usage, and dye chemical inventory.” Review and publish.
- Supplier Onboarding – Share the form link and a short video tutorial. Enable the built‑in chatbot for instant Q&A.
- Integration with Existing PLM/ERP – Leverage Formize.ai’s REST API to push submitted data into the brand’s product lifecycle management system.
- Dashboard Configuration – Define key performance indicators (KPIs) such as kg CO₂e per garment, percentage of recycled fibers, and compliance score.
- Continuous Improvement – Schedule monthly reviews of validation rules and AI model accuracy. Adjust prompts to capture emerging sustainability metrics (e.g., micro‑plastic release).
